FanDuel NFL DFS Lineup Picks (Week 6): Daily Fantasy Football Advice

Tom Vecchio highlights the top FanDuel NFL DFS lineup picks for Week 6, and a couple of sleepers to consider while building daily rosters.

RotoBallers, welcome to Week 6 of the daily fantasy football season. In this column, you will find my recommended FanDuel DFS Lineup Picks to target for Week 6 of the NFL season. You can also click here to find more DFS analysis articles and tools.

The goal is to identify players to start on FanDuel this week based on various factors including the opponent, the player's opportunity, analysis of the game's matchups, and the FanDuel price.

Let's find some DFS lineup sleepers, and win on FanDuel. Good luck in Week 6! Find me @DFS_Tom if you have any questions.

FanDuel Quarterbacks - Week 6 DFS Picks

Deshaun Watson - QB, HOU vs BUF (FD - $8,100)

Watson could go a bit overlooked this week since this game comes in with an over-under set at 41, which is one of the two lowest games on the slate. Regardless of that, Watson has shown to be viable in all formats each week, with a solid floor and a good ceiling. He has over 300 yards in four straight games and has multiple touchdowns in three of his last four games. Watson also has 16 rushing attempts in his last two games, showing he is getting back to what we saw from him last season. He has the rushing touchdown upside, which is always great in tournaments.

Jameis Winston - QB, TB @ ATL (FD - $7,400)

Winston is being talked up by many across the industry as a cash game play this week since he has a few different things going in his favor. First off, this game has an over-under 58, which is highest on the slate, so plenty of fantasy points to go around. Second, he is up against the Falcons, who come in with the 28th DVOA versus the pass and the 31st DVOA vs the rush. Winston has always shown the ability to throw for over 300 yards and multiple touchdowns, but it may come with an interception or two.

 

FanDuel Running Backs - Week 6 DFS Picks

Carlos Hyde - RB, CLE vs LAC (FD - $6,600)

Hyde has seen 17 or more total touches in every single game this season and is now up against the Chargers, who come in with the 21st DVOA vs the rush and the 16th DVOA vs the pass. We have this game coming in with an over-under set at 44.5 and is being talked up as a game which could hit the over. He only played on 35% of the snaps last week, but prior to that, he was at or above 58% of the snaps for three straight weeks.

Tevin Coleman - RB, ATL vs TB (FD - $6,300)

Coleman may be seeing the starting role again for Atlanta since Devonta Freeman is dealing with yet another injury. When Freeman was out earlier in the year, Coleman played on 63%, 78%, and 57% of the snaps in Weeks 2-4. This game has an over-under set at 58, so you want, no, need to be getting exposure to this game somehow, and Coleman is a great option. He had double-digit rushing attempts in that three-week span, along with 10 total targets.

 

FanDuel Wide Receivers - Week 6 DFS Picks

Quincy Enunwa - WR, NYJ vs IND (FD - $5,800)

Enuwa had a bad game last week, but the Jets put up over 300 yards on the ground, so he really didn't have to do too much. Feeling a big bounce-back game for him this week, as he still has 29% of the teams total market share. That target share is massive and shown by his eight or more targets in the first four weeks of the season. He should see a good amount of Colts cornerback Quincy Wilson, who is giving up 0.68 fantasy points per route run this season.

Tyler Boyd - WR, CIN vs PIT (FD - $6,300)

This game also has a higher over-under which is set at 52.5, so plenty of offense to go around here. Boyd has seven or more targets in each of his last four games and is being targeted on in the passing game on 24% of his routes run. With that usage, he has been able to rack up 0.47 fantasy points per route run, which should put him in a prime spot, since A.J. Green will most likely be shadowed by Joe Haden.

 

FanDuel Tight End - Week 6 DFS Pick

Kyle Rudolph - TE, MIN vs ARI (FD - $6,200)

Tight ends are generally pretty tough to get right on a week to week basis, but Rudolph has shown to be pretty consistent as of late. He has five or more receptions in four straight games, 48 or more yards in three of those games, but only one touchdown in that span. When the Vikings are in the red zone this season, he is their go-to guy, with a 32% market share of targets.

 

FanDuel Defense - Week 6 DFS Pick

Carolina Panthers at Washington Redskins (FD - $3,900)

The Panthers are the 10th most expensive defense on the slate this week, so you really aren't paying up for some potential points. The have three sacks and six intercetions in the past two weeks and while the intercpetion rate isn't sustainable, the QB pressure is what you should be after. Thisg game only has an over-under at 44.5, which isn't too high, so a nice spot to fade some of the more expensive teams in lower scoring games, ie, Jaguars, Vikings.
